Just three days a5er winning its second consecutive national championship, Penn State landed Pennsylvania's best re- cruit for the Class of 2018. Gavin Teasdale, who won his third state championship this past season for Jefferson-Morgan High in Greene County, announced March 21 on Twitter that he would be switching his verbal commitment to the Nittany Lions. Teasdale had originally announced last April that he planned to wrestle for Iowa. Teasdale is the No. 2 overall prospect in the country for his class, according to FloWrestling.com. The nation's top- rated recruit, heavyweight Gable Steve- son of Apple Valley, Minn., said in March that he plans to attend Min- nesota. Teasdale has a 122-0 career record at Je4erson-Morgan and 3nished his junior season with a 40-0 mark at 126 pounds.
